01Tell me about yourself

  • The key to answering this question is to be concise and focused.
  • Start by providing a brief overview of your professional background and qualifications.
  • Highlight your relevant experiences and skills that make you a strong fit for the position.
  • Avoid personal details or unrelated information.
  • Practice your response beforehand to ensure a confident delivery.

02Why are you interested in this position?

  • Demonstrate your knowledge about the company and the role.
  • Explain how your skills and experiences align with the job requirements.
  • Highlight the opportunities for growth and development that the position offers.
  • Show enthusiasm and genuine interest in the company and its values.
  • Avoid generic answers and tailor your response to the specific position.

03What are your strengths and weaknesses?

  • When discussing your strengths, focus on those that are relevant to the job.
  • Provide examples or anecdotes that demonstrate your skills in action.
  • Be honest about your weaknesses, but emphasize the steps you have taken to address them.
  • Discuss how you have overcome challenges and continue to improve.
  • Avoid listing generic strengths or weaknesses without supporting evidence.

04How do you handle stress or pressure?

  • Describe a specific situation where you successfully managed stress or pressure.
  • Explain the strategies you employed to stay calm and focused.
  • Highlight any positive outcomes or lessons learned from the experience.
  • Demonstrate your ability to adapt and problem-solve in challenging situations.
  • Avoid exaggerating or fabricating a story – be truthful and provide genuine examples.

05Do you have any questions for us?

  • Prepare a list of thoughtful and specific questions to ask at the end of the interview.
  • Inquire about the company culture, team dynamics, or future projects.
  • Demonstrate your interest and engagement in the opportunity.
  • Avoid asking questions that can easily be found on the company's website.
  • Engage in active listening during the interview to come up with relevant questions.
